Key Features of the Course

The Level 3 Diploma in Early Years Education and Care is comprehensive and covers a wide range of topics. Below is a breakdown of the course structure and key modules:

Module Description Importance
Child Development Understanding the physical, emotional, and cognitive development of children. Essential for tailoring activities to meet individual needs.
EYFS Framework Learning the principles and practices of the Early Years Foundation Stage. Ensures compliance with national standards.
Safeguarding and Welfare Protecting children's well-being and ensuring a safe environment. Critical for maintaining trust and safety.
Play and Learning Using play as a tool for learning and development. Enhances creativity and problem-solving skills.
Partnership with Families Building strong relationships with parents and caregivers. Supports holistic child development.
